John,

Yep, all the way up. And to get it to ignore it, just add one in your own
folder.

Subject: Ignoring Application.cfc or .cfm

Is there a tag I can use on my page to ignore an application.cfc in the root
directory? 

Additionally, how many directories above the page being called will CF
travel to look for an application.cfc or .cfm file? Will it look keep going
until it reaches the server root directory?
